I am about to give up on my guitar dream!

I got so inspired - in fact I was actually completely convinced I would be able to get there some day. My fingers would move smoothly up and down the neck and my guitar would scream for me.

But now...the feeling is gone. Lots of other things have come in between and I can't really find the time or inspiration to play guitar. Weird - just a while back it felt as this was my calling.

But wait a minute! How come only a few people are capable of ripping it up on the guitar? Hmm...well because it is actually quite difficult. So if I want to learn something that only a few people can do, then I can't do what others do: give up.

Right now - I have a choice: I can either let it go...or I can pick it up again. I can choose to do as most people have done OR to do as my heroes have done: NEVER GIVE UP!

* Stevie Ray Vaughan wouldn't have made it if he had put the guitar down when he first attempted to play a barre chord.

* Yngwie wouldn't shred they way he does if he hadn't struggled with those scales day and night.

* Joe Satriani wouldn't have written any hit songs if he only had learned the pentatonic scale.

* Me: I never made it because I didn't remain inspired. I could have, but I didn't. And now it's too late..

Wait a minute - it's not too late! I can still do it, if I prove to myself that I am not the type who gives up. If I can do that, then it means that I have the same will and determination as my heroes.
